Curve Tree Structure
Layer 0 (Leaves) : Ed25519 output tuples (O, I, C) → Selene (C1) hashes Layer 1 (Interior) : Selene (C1) → Helios (C2) commitments Layer 2 (Interior) : Helios (C2) → Selene (C1) commitments Layer 4 (Root) : Helios (C2) tree root
The full output set is committed into a Helios/Selene curve tree. Each leaf encodes an output tuple (O, I, C) as Selene curve points. Interior nodes alternate between Helios and Selene curves, enabling efficient recursive proof composition.

Spend-Auth & Linkability (SAL) Proof
ÕRerandomized one-time key
ĨRerandomized linking tag
RRerandomization scalar
C̃Rerandomized Pedersen commitment
The SAL proof demonstrates knowledge of the secret spend key, correct key image formation, and that the balance equation holds: Σ pseudo-outs = Σ output commitments + fee.
Verification Pipeline
1Deserialize FCMP++ proof from transaction
2Extract tree root (Helios (C2)), layers, key images
3Reconstruct signable hash from tx prefix
4Verify Generalized Bulletproofs+ arithmetic circuit
5Verify Helios/Selene curve tree membership (per input)
6Verify SAL proof (spend authorization + linkability)
7Check key image uniqueness (double-spend prevention)
✓Consensus acceptance
